I have the Wallenstein BX62 without hydraulic feed. I have no brush, leaves or small stuff to feed so manual feed is fine. I feed all my pine trees in whole( no branch removal). The BX62 works much better, for me, than my previous BX42. The smaller chipper would plug on all the pine needles on the trees. I've yet to have a plug up with the '62. The '62 has a larger discharge chute and higher air flow which chucks those sticky pine needles out just fine.

I was initially looking at Valby & Vermeer chippers but there are no local dealers.
